JUDGMENT

C.K. Abdul Rehim, J The petitioners are the respondents in O.P.No.1481/2013 pending before the Family Court, Chavara. The case was instituted by the respondent seeking for return of money and gold ornaments. It was originally instituted before the Family Court, Kollam as O.P.No.212/2010. It is stated that the petitioners have filed written statement in the case as early as in October 2011 and the case was transferred at the time when it was ripe for trial. It is alleged that the respondent is not interested in prosecuting the case and she seldom appear before the Family Court. Once the case was dismissed for default of the respondent, on 26.04.2013. But it was restored thereafter and transferred to the Family Court, Chavara. It is stated that the first petitioner is a Government employee and the frequent postings in the case is causing difficulty to him. Further it is

apprehended that he may get a transfer during this year. It is also mentioned that the 2nd petitioner is an aged lady suffering from various illness and the 3rd petitioner, who is the sister of the first petitioner, is unnecessarily dragged on to this case. Under the above mentioned circumstances, the petitioners are approaching this court seeking direction for an early disposal of the case pending before the Family Court, by invoking supervisory jurisdiction vested by this court under Article 227 of the Constitution of India.

2.

Despite service of notice from this court, the respondent has not chosen to enter appearance or contest the case. A report was called for from the Family Court, Chavara. The learned Judge had reported that O.P.No.1481/2013 stands posted for hearing on 03.07.2015 along with I.A.No.361/2015, filed seeking to amend the O.P. It is further reported that six months time is required for disposal of the case. 3.

This court takes note of the report submitted by the Family Court expressing willingness to dispose of the matter within a period of six months. On that basis the writ petition is hereby disposed of by directing the Family Court, Chavara to

take earnest efforts for an early disposal of the matter, within the time mentioned as above.
